•Bipolaris is a dematiaceous, filamentous fungus. It is cosmopolitan in nature and is isolated from plant debris and soil. The pathogenic species have known teleomorphic states in the genus Cochliobolus and produce ascospores. •Bipolaris colonies grow rapidly, reaching a diameter of 3 to 9 cm following incubation at 25°C for 7 days on potato dextrose agar. The colony becomes mature within 5 days. The texture is velvety to woolly. The surface of the colony is initially white to grayish brown and becomes olive green to black with a raised grayish periphery as it matures. The reverse is also darkly pigmented and olive to black in color •The hyphae are septate and brown. Conidiophores (4.5-6 µm wide) are brown, simple or branched, geniculate and sympodial, bending at the points where each conidium arises from. This property leads to the zigzag appearance of the conidiophore. The conidia, which are also called poroconidia, are 3- to 6-celled, fusoid to cylindrical in shape, light to dark brown in color and have sympodial geniculate growth pattern. The poroconidium (30-35 µm x 11-13.5 µm) is distoseptate and has a scarcely protuberant, darkly pigmented hilum. This basal scar indicates the point of attachment to the conidiophore. From the terminal cell of the conidium, germ tubes may develop and elongate in the direction of longitudinal axis of the conidium. •Bipolaris is one of the causative agents of phaeohyphomycosis. The clinical spectrum is diverse, including allergic and chronic invasive sinusitis, keratitis, endophthalmitis, endocarditis, endarteritis, osteomyelitis, meningoencephalitis, peritonitis, otitis media (in agricultural field workers),and fungemia as well as cutaneous and pulmonary infections and allergic bronchopulmonary disease.
